Analyst Views & Fundamentals
Analysts are broadly neutral on Pfizer. The simple average rating stands at 3.00, while the performance-weighted rating is only 1.10, indicating a lack of strong conviction among analysts. There’s no strong consensus, and recent analyst ratings have been mixed.
These ratings contrast with the recent 1.99% price rise, suggesting market optimism may be ahead of analyst expectations. Here’s how the fundamentals stack up:
- Gross Profit Margin: 76.65% (internal diagnostic score: 2.00) – a strong margin, but the score reflects some uncertainty about sustainability.
- Inventory Turnover Ratio: 0.59x (2.00) – slow turnover may indicate weak demand or overstocking.
- Net Profit Margin (NPM): 19.98% (2.49) – a solid margin, but the score reflects moderate confidence.
- CFOA (Cash Flow from Operating Activities): -0.28% (2.22) – weak operating cash flow is a red flag in the model’s eyes.
- Return on Total Assets: -8.95% (1.52) – negative returns suggest poor asset utilization.
Money-Flow Trends
Fund flows are mostly bearish across all sizes of institutional activity. The overall fund flow score is 7.82 (good), which might be misleading at first glance. However, the inflow ratios for all categories are slightly below 50%, indicating that big money is cautious:
- Large- and Extra-large-cap funds: inflow ratios are about 49% – a bearish sign as large players typically drive momentum.
- Medium and Small-cap flows: also negative, with inflow ratios in the 48% range – a further signal of caution.
In summary, big money is not showing strong bullish intent, while retail activity remains muted and uninformative at this time.
Key Technical Signals
The technical outlook for PFEPFE-- is not promising. Internal diagnostic scores are as follows:
- Williams %R Overbought: 1.00 – a strong bearish signal
- RSI Overbought: 2.99 – a moderate bearish signal
Looking at recent chart patterns:
- On 2025-08-22: Both WR and RSI overbought indicators were active, suggesting a potential reversal or correction.
- On 2025-08-21: WR overbought again appeared, reinforcing bearish momentum.
- From 2025-08-18 to 2025-08-20: WR overbought was active on all days, showing prolonged overbought conditions.
According to the model’s key technical insights:
- Technical indicators show that the market is in a weak state.
- Bearish signals are dominant (2 bearish vs 0 bullish), which points to a high risk of a downward correction.
